NYCEDC seeks RFEI for sale/redevelopment of 46-acres
New York City Economic Development Corp. (NYCEDC), on behalf of the city, is seeking expressions of interest for the purchase and redevelopment of all or select portion(s) of a 46-acre parcel located in the Willowbrook neighborhood.
